Bug 343035 - KNotify crash
Summary: KNotify crash
Status: RESOLVED WORKSFORME
Alias: None
Product: Phonon
Classification: Frameworks and Libraries
Component: general (other bugs)
Version First Reported In: unspecified
Platform: openSUSE Linux
: NOR crash
Target Milestone: ---
Assignee: Harald Sitter
URL:
Keywords: drkonqi, triaged
Depends on:
Blocks:
 
Reported: 2015-01-19 09:52 UTC by floux.dp
Modified: 2018-10-27 02:42 UTC (History)
3 users (show)

See Also:
Latest Commit:
Version Fixed In:
Sentry Crash Report: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description floux.dp 2015-01-19 09:52:18 UTC
Application: knotify4 (4.14.3)
KDE Platform Version: 4.14.3
Qt Version: 4.8.6
Operating System: Linux 3.16.7-7-desktop x86_64
Distribution: "openSUSE 13.2 (Harlequin) (x86_64)"

-- Information about the crash:
- What I was doing when the application crashed:

I was copying folders on an FTP server and so I get many notifications to notify me of the succes. After some notification (16+ ?) KNotify crashed.

-- Backtrace:
Application: KNotify (knotify4), signal: Segmentation fault
Using host libthread_db library "/lib64/libthread_db.so.1".
[Current thread is 1 (Thread 0x7f92c8fce800 (LWP 1849))]

Thread 9 (Thread 0x7f92b59d7700 (LWP 1864)):
#0  0x00007f92c61a73cd in poll () at /lib64/libc.so.6
#1  0x00007f92c3810be4 in  () at /usr/lib64/libglib-2.0.so.0
#2  0x00007f92c3810cec in g_main_context_iteration () at /usr/lib64/libglib-2.0.so.0
#3  0x00007f92c692a0de in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) (this=0x7f92b00008c0, flags=...) at kernel/qeventdispatcher_glib.cpp:452
#4  0x00007f92c68fbe6f in QEventLoop::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) (this=this@entry=0x7f92b59d6da0, flags=...) at kernel/qeventloop.cpp:149
#5  0x00007f92c68fc165 in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) (this=this@entry=0x7f92b59d6da0, flags=...) at kernel/qeventloop.cpp:204
#6  0x00007f92c67f90bf in QThread::exec() (this=this@entry=0x150bf00) at thread/qthread.cpp:538
#7  0x00007f92c68dd783 in QInotifyFileSystemWatcherEngine::run() (this=0x150bf00) at io/qfilesystemwatcher_inotify.cpp:265
#8  0x00007f92c67fb79f in QThreadPrivate::start(void*) (arg=0x150bf00) at thread/qthread_unix.cpp:349
#9  0x00007f92c422d0a4 in start_thread () at /lib64/libpthread.so.0
#10 0x00007f92c61af7fd in clone () at /lib64/libc.so.6

Thread 8 (Thread 0x7f92935f1700 (LWP 18801)):
#0  0x00007f92c61a73cd in poll () at /lib64/libc.so.6
#1  0x00007f92c3d0aa41 in  () at /usr/lib64/libpulse.so.0
#2  0x00007f92c3cfc2ec in pa_mainloop_poll () at /usr/lib64/libpulse.so.0
#3  0x00007f92c3cfc95e in pa_mainloop_iterate () at /usr/lib64/libpulse.so.0
#4  0x00007f92c3cfca10 in pa_mainloop_run () at /usr/lib64/libpulse.so.0
#5  0x00007f92c3d0a9f3 in  () at /usr/lib64/libpulse.so.0
#6  0x00007f92c08a1808 in  () at /usr/lib64/pulseaudio/libpulsecommon-5.0.so
#7  0x00007f92c422d0a4 in start_thread () at /lib64/libpthread.so.0
#8  0x00007f92c61af7fd in clone () at /lib64/libc.so.6

Thread 7 (Thread 0x7f92925ef700 (LWP 18802)):
#0  0x00007f92c61ab789 in syscall () at /lib64/libc.so.6
#1  0x00007f92c3852a1c in g_cond_wait () at /usr/lib64/libglib-2.0.so.0
#2  0x00007f92b46d6365 in  () at /usr/lib64/libgstreamer-1.0.so.0
#3  0x00007f92c383650c in  () at /usr/lib64/libglib-2.0.so.0
#4  0x00007f92c3835b85 in  () at /usr/lib64/libglib-2.0.so.0
#5  0x00007f92c422d0a4 in start_thread () at /lib64/libpthread.so.0
#6  0x00007f92c61af7fd in clone () at /lib64/libc.so.6

Thread 6 (Thread 0x7f9291dee700 (LWP 18803)):
#0  0x00007f92c61ab789 in syscall () at /lib64/libc.so.6
#1  0x00007f92c3852a1c in g_cond_wait () at /usr/lib64/libglib-2.0.so.0
#2  0x00007f92b46d6365 in  () at /usr/lib64/libgstreamer-1.0.so.0
#3  0x00007f92c383650c in  () at /usr/lib64/libglib-2.0.so.0
#4  0x00007f92c3835b85 in  () at /usr/lib64/libglib-2.0.so.0
#5  0x00007f92c422d0a4 in start_thread () at /lib64/libpthread.so.0
#6  0x00007f92c61af7fd in clone () at /lib64/libc.so.6

Thread 5 (Thread 0x7f9292df0700 (LWP 18804)):
#0  0x00007f92c61ab789 in syscall () at /lib64/libc.so.6
#1  0x00007f92c3852a1c in g_cond_wait () at /usr/lib64/libglib-2.0.so.0
#2  0x00007f92b46d6365 in  () at /usr/lib64/libgstreamer-1.0.so.0
#3  0x00007f92c383650c in  () at /usr/lib64/libglib-2.0.so.0
#4  0x00007f92c3835b85 in  () at /usr/lib64/libglib-2.0.so.0
#5  0x00007f92c422d0a4 in start_thread () at /lib64/libpthread.so.0
#6  0x00007f92c61af7fd in clone () at /lib64/libc.so.6

Thread 4 (Thread 0x7f92a7a3e700 (LWP 18805)):
#0  0x00007f92c61ab789 in syscall () at /lib64/libc.so.6
#1  0x00007f92c3852a1c in g_cond_wait () at /usr/lib64/libglib-2.0.so.0
#2  0x00007f92a1d9eb1d in  () at /usr/lib64/gstreamer-1.0/libgstcoreelements.so
#3  0x00007f92b46d61a6 in  () at /usr/lib64/libgstreamer-1.0.so.0
#4  0x00007f92c383650c in  () at /usr/lib64/libglib-2.0.so.0
#5  0x00007f92c3835b85 in  () at /usr/lib64/libglib-2.0.so.0
#6  0x00007f92c422d0a4 in start_thread () at /lib64/libpthread.so.0
#7  0x00007f92c61af7fd in clone () at /lib64/libc.so.6

Thread 3 (Thread 0x7f92a170b700 (LWP 18806)):
#0  0x00007f92c61ab789 in syscall () at /lib64/libc.so.6
#1  0x00007f92c3852a1c in g_cond_wait () at /usr/lib64/libglib-2.0.so.0
#2  0x00007f92a1d9eb1d in  () at /usr/lib64/gstreamer-1.0/libgstcoreelements.so
#3  0x00007f92b46d61a6 in  () at /usr/lib64/libgstreamer-1.0.so.0
#4  0x00007f92c383650c in  () at /usr/lib64/libglib-2.0.so.0
#5  0x00007f92c3835b85 in  () at /usr/lib64/libglib-2.0.so.0
#6  0x00007f92c422d0a4 in start_thread () at /lib64/libpthread.so.0
#7  0x00007f92c61af7fd in clone () at /lib64/libc.so.6

Thread 2 (Thread 0x7f92a08b1700 (LWP 18807)):
#0  0x00007f92c61ab789 in syscall () at /lib64/libc.so.6
#1  0x00007f92c3852a1c in g_cond_wait () at /usr/lib64/libglib-2.0.so.0
#2  0x00007f92a1d9eb1d in  () at /usr/lib64/gstreamer-1.0/libgstcoreelements.so
#3  0x00007f92b46d61a6 in  () at /usr/lib64/libgstreamer-1.0.so.0
#4  0x00007f92c383650c in  () at /usr/lib64/libglib-2.0.so.0
#5  0x00007f92c3835b85 in  () at /usr/lib64/libglib-2.0.so.0
#6  0x00007f92c422d0a4 in start_thread () at /lib64/libpthread.so.0
#7  0x00007f92c61af7fd in clone () at /lib64/libc.so.6

Thread 1 (Thread 0x7f92c8fce800 (LWP 1849)):
[KCrash Handler]
#6  0x00007f92c85a6503 in  () at /usr/lib64/libphonon.so.4
#7  0x00007f92c85a7c89 in  () at /usr/lib64/libphonon.so.4
#8  0x00007f92c691559e in QObject::event(QEvent*) (this=0x150a040, e=<optimized out>) at kernel/qobject.cpp:1231
#9  0x00007f92c758876c in QApplicationPrivate::notify_helper(QObject*, QEvent*) (this=this@entry=0x1340390, receiver=receiver@entry=0x150a040, e=e@entry=0x1861000) at kernel/qapplication.cpp:4565
#10 0x00007f92c758ecad in QApplication::notify(QObject*, QEvent*) (this=this@entry=0x7fffe3ad3b50, receiver=receiver@entry=0x150a040, e=e@entry=0x1861000) at kernel/qapplication.cpp:4351
#11 0x00007f92c8a11baa in KApplication::notify(QObject*, QEvent*) (this=0x7fffe3ad3b50, receiver=0x150a040, event=0x1861000) at /usr/src/debug/kdelibs-4.14.3/kdeui/kernel/kapplication.cpp:311
#12 0x00007f92c68fd2ad in QCoreApplication::notifyInternal(QObject*, QEvent*) (this=0x7fffe3ad3b50, receiver=receiver@entry=0x150a040, event=event@entry=0x1861000) at kernel/qcoreapplication.cpp:953
#13 0x00007f92c690057d in QCoreApplicationPrivate::sendPostedEvents(QObject*, int, QThreadData*) (event=0x1861000, receiver=0x150a040) at kernel/qcoreapplication.h:231
#14 0x00007f92c690057d in QCoreApplicationPrivate::sendPostedEvents(QObject*, int, QThreadData*) (receiver=receiver@entry=0x0, event_type=event_type@entry=0, data=0x1306630) at kernel/qcoreapplication.cpp:1577
#15 0x00007f92c6900a23 in QCoreApplication::sendPostedEvents(QObject*, int) (receiver=receiver@entry=0x0, event_type=event_type@entry=0) at kernel/qcoreapplication.cpp:1470
#16 0x00007f92c692a8fe in postEventSourceDispatch(GSource*, GSourceFunc, gpointer) () at kernel/qcoreapplication.h:236
#17 0x00007f92c692a8fe in postEventSourceDispatch(GSource*, GSourceFunc, gpointer) (s=0x1344980) at kernel/qeventdispatcher_glib.cpp:300
#18 0x00007f92c3810a04 in g_main_context_dispatch () at /usr/lib64/libglib-2.0.so.0
#19 0x00007f92c3810c48 in  () at /usr/lib64/libglib-2.0.so.0
#20 0x00007f92c3810cec in g_main_context_iteration () at /usr/lib64/libglib-2.0.so.0
#21 0x00007f92c692a0be in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) (this=0x130bab0, flags=...) at kernel/qeventdispatcher_glib.cpp:450
#22 0x00007f92c7625676 in QGuiE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) (this=<optimized out>, flags=...) at kernel/qguieventdispatcher_glib.cpp:204
#23 0x00007f92c68fbe6f in QEventLoop::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) (this=this@entry=0x7fffe3ad3a60, flags=...) at kernel/qeventloop.cpp:149
#24 0x00007f92c68fc165 in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) (this=this@entry=0x7fffe3ad3a60, flags=...) at kernel/qeventloop.cpp:204
#25 0x00007f92c69015b9 in QCoreApplication::exec() () at kernel/qcoreapplication.cpp:1225
#26 0x000000000040a255 in  ()
#27 0x00007f92c60ebb05 in __libc_start_main () at /lib64/libc.so.6
#28 0x000000000040a318 in _start ()

Reported using DrKonqi
Comment 1 Christoph Feck 2015-01-20 22:08:58 UTC
If this is reproducible, please install debug symbols for phonon, and add an updated backtrace. For more information, please see https://techbase.kde.org/Development/Tutorials/Debugging/How_to_create_useful_crash_reports
Comment 2 Andrew Crouthamel 2018-09-25 03:33:14 UTC
Dear Bug Submitter,

This bug has been in NEEDSINFO status with no change for at least 15 days. Please provide the requested information as soon as possible and set the bug status as REPORTED. Due to regular bug tracker maintenance, if the bug is still in NEEDSINFO status with no change in 30 days, the bug will be closed as RESOLVED > WORKSFORME due to lack of needed information.

For more information about our bug triaging procedures please read the wiki located here: https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

If you have already provided the requested information, please set the bug status as REPORTED so that the KDE team knows that the bug is ready to be confirmed.

Thank you for helping us make KDE software even better for everyone!
Comment 3 Andrew Crouthamel 2018-10-27 02:42:53 UTC
Dear Bug Submitter,

This bug has been in NEEDSINFO status with no change for at least 30 days. The bug is now closed as RESOLVED > WORKSFORME due to lack of needed information.

For more information about our bug triaging procedures please read the wiki located here: https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

Thank you for helping us make KDE software even better for everyone!